ZX Grand Tiger I Double cab pick-up 2.4 MT 2007 - 2013
Engine capacity, cm³ 2,351 Fuel Type 95
Power 126 hp Drive four wheel drive
Gearbox type mechanics -
Engine's type petrol Average fuel consumption per 100 km 13 l.

General information
Car brand ZX
Model Grand Tiger
Generation I
Modification 2.4 MT
Country brand China
Vehicle class J
Body type Double cab pick-up
Number of doors 4
Number of seats 5
Dimensions
Length, mm 5,310
Width, mm 1,812
Height, mm 1,735
Wheelbase, mm 3,100
Front track, mm 1,532
Rear track, mm 1,537
Ground clearance, mm 202
The size of tires 235/70/R16
Weight and volume
Weight, kg 1610
Curb Weight, kg 2110
The fuel tank, l. 73
Transmission
Gearbox type mechanics
Number of gears 5
Drive four wheel drive
Performance
Maximum speed 140 km/h
Average fuel consumption per 100 km 13 l.
Environmental standard Euro 2
Fuel Type 95
Engine
Engine's type petrol
Power system distributed injection (multi-point)
Boost type no
Engine capacity, cm³ 2,351
Power 126 hp
Power, kWt) 93
Torque 193 Nm
When rpm 5200
Location of cylinders inline
Number of cylinders 4
Number of valves per cylinder 4
Bore and stroke 86.5 × 100 mm
Compression ratio 9.5
Suspension and brakes
Type front suspension independent, spring
Front brakes disc
Rear brakes drum
